How to split pdfs
Add your PDFChoose the PDF you want to split.
Pick how to splitSplit every page into its own file, or select a page range to pull out.
SplitRun it — your pages are separated in seconds.
DownloadDownload the results as a ZIP. Everything is gone the instant your download is ready.
What you can do
- Send someone just the pages they need, not the whole file
- Break a scanned bundle into one document per record
- Pull a single chapter or section out of a long report
- Separate a multi-invoice export into individual invoices
- Split a signed packet back into its component documents

Frequently asked questions
- Are my files kept after splitting?
- No. Your PDF is never stored — the instant your ZIP is ready to download, everything is gone, and no one ever sees your file.
- How does the split come back to me?
- Selected pages are packaged into a single ZIP so you can grab everything in one download.
- Can I split out just one range?
- Yes. Choose a page range (say pages 5–12) and pull exactly that out as its own file.
- Does splitting change quality?
- No. Pages are copied as-is with no re-compression, so nothing is degraded.
- Is there a page limit?
- No hard limit — large documents split fine, they just take a moment longer.
- Do I need an account?
- No. Splitting is free, with no sign-up and no watermark.
- Will the original be modified?
- Never. You always get new files; your source PDF is left exactly as it was.
